- The appliance is not intended for children under
the age of 15 years. Teenagers aged between
15 and 18 years can use the appliance with the
consent and/or assistance of their parents or
the persons who have parental authority over
them. Adults from 19 years and older can use the
appliance freely.
- Only use the adapter supplied.
- Do not use the appliance or the adapter if it is
damaged.
- The adapter contains a transformer. Do not cut
off the adapter to replace it with another plug, as
this causes a hazardous situation.
- If the adapter is damaged, always have it replaced with
one of the original type in order to avoid a hazard.
- Do not use the appliance if the glass of the light
exit window is broken.

To prevent damage

- Make sure that nothing obstructs the air flow
through the ventilation slots.
- Never subject the appliance to heavy shocks and
do not shake or drop it.
- If you take the appliance from a very cold
environment to a very warm environment or vice
versa, wait approximately 3 hours before you use it.
- Store the appliance in its original box so that it
does not become dusty.
- Do not expose the appliance to temperatures
lower than 10°C or higher than 35°C during use.
- To prevent damage, do not expose the appliance
to direct sunlight or UV light for several hours.
- Do not flash against any other surface than the
skin. This can cause severe damage to the light exit
window or the skin colour sensor. Only flash when
the appliance is in contact with the skin.
